"""
Various utilities for loading JS dependencies and rendering plots
inside the Jupyter notebook.
"""
import json
import uuid
import sys
from contextlib import contextmanager
from collections import OrderedDict
from six import string_types
import bokeh
import bokeh.embed.notebook
from bokeh.core.json_encoder import serialize_json
from bokeh.core.templates import MACROS
from bokeh.document import Document
from bokeh.embed import server_document
from bokeh.embed.elements import div_for_render_item, script_for_render_items
from bokeh.embed.util import standalone_docs_json_and_render_items
from bokeh.embed.wrappers import wrap_in_script_tag
from bokeh.models import LayoutDOM, Model
from bokeh.resources import CDN, INLINE
from bokeh.settings import settings, _Unset
from bokeh.util.serialization import make_id
from pyviz_comms import (
PYVIZ_PROXY, Comm, JupyterCommManager as _JupyterCommManager, nb_mime_js
)
try:
from bokeh.util.string import escape
except Exception:
from html import escape
from ..compiler import require_components
from .embed import embed_state
from .model import add_to_doc, diff
from .resources import Bundle, Resources, _env, bundle_resources
from .server import _server_url, _origin_url, get_server
from .state import state
#---------------------------------------------------------------------
# Private API
#---------------------------------------------------------------------
LOAD_MIME = 'application/vnd.holoviews_load.v0+json'
EXEC_MIME = 'application/vnd.holoviews_exec.v0+json'
HTML_MIME = 'text/html'
def _jupyter_server_extension_paths():
return [{"module": "panel.io.jupyter_server_extension"}]
def push(doc, comm, binary=True):
"""
Pushes events stored on the document across the provided comm.
"""
msg = diff(doc, binary=binary)
if msg is None:
return
comm.send(msg.header_json)
comm.send(msg.metadata_json)
comm.send(msg.content_json)
for header, payload in msg.buffers:
comm.send(json.dumps(header))
comm.send(buffers=[payload])
def push_on_root(ref):
if ref not in state._views:
return
(self, root, doc, comm) = state._views[ref]
if comm and 'embedded' not in root.tags:
push(doc, comm)
def push_notebook(*objs):
"""
A utility for pushing updates to the frontend given a Panel
object. This is required when modifying any Bokeh object directly
in a notebook session.
Arguments
---------
objs: panel.viewable.Viewable
"""
for obj in objs:
for ref in obj._models:
push_on_root(ref)
DOC_NB_JS = _env.get_template("doc_nb_js.js")

def render_mimebundle(model, doc, comm, manager=None, location=None):
"""
Displays bokeh output inside a notebook using the PyViz display
and comms machinery.
"""
if not isinstance(model, LayoutDOM):
raise ValueError('Can only render bokeh LayoutDOM models')
add_to_doc(model, doc, True)
if manager is not None:
doc.add_root(manager)
if location is not None:
loc = location._get_model(doc, model, model, comm)
doc.add_root(loc)
return render_model(model, comm)
def mimebundle_to_html(bundle):
"""
Converts a MIME bundle into HTML.
"""
if isinstance(bundle, tuple):
data, metadata = bundle
else:
data = bundle
html = data.get('text/html', '')
if 'application/javascript' in data:
js = data['application/javascript']
html += '\n<script type="application/javascript">{js}</script>'.format(js=js)
return html
#---------------------------------------------------------------------
# Public API
#---------------------------------------------------------------------
@contextmanager
def block_comm():
"""
Context manager to temporarily block comm push
"""
state._hold = True
try:
yield
finally:
state._hold = False
def load_notebook(inline=True, load_timeout=5000):
from IPython.display import publish_display_data
resources = INLINE if inline else CDN
prev_resources = settings.resources(default="server")
user_resources = settings.resources._user_value is not _Unset
resources = Resources.from_bokeh(resources)
try:
bundle = bundle_resources(None, resources)
bundle = Bundle.from_bokeh(bundle)
configs, requirements, exports, skip_imports = require_components()
ipywidget = 'ipywidgets_bokeh' in sys.modules
bokeh_js = _autoload_js(bundle, configs, requirements, exports,
skip_imports, ipywidget, load_timeout)
finally:
if user_resources:
settings.resources = prev_resources
else:
settings.resources.unset_value()
publish_display_data({
'application/javascript': bokeh_js,
LOAD_MIME: bokeh_js,
})
bokeh.io.notebook.curstate().output_notebook()
# Publish comm manager
JS = '\n'.join([PYVIZ_PROXY, _JupyterCommManager.js_manager, nb_mime_js])
publish_display_data(data={LOAD_MIME: JS, 'application/javascript': JS})
def show_server(panel, notebook_url, port):
"""
Displays a bokeh server inline in the notebook.
Arguments
---------
panel: Viewable
Panel Viewable object to launch a server for
notebook_url: str
The URL of the running Jupyter notebook server
port: int (optional, default=0)
Allows specifying a specific port
server_id: str
Unique ID to identify the server with
Returns
-------
server: bokeh.server.Server
"""
from IPython.display import publish_display_data
if callable(notebook_url):
origin = notebook_url(None)
else:
origin = _origin_url(notebook_url)
server_id = uuid.uuid4().hex
server = get_server(panel, port=port, websocket_origin=origin,
start=True, show=False, server_id=server_id)
if callable(notebook_url):
url = notebook_url(server.port)
else:
url = _server_url(notebook_url, server.port)
script = server_document(url, resources=None)
publish_display_data({
HTML_MIME: script,
EXEC_MIME: ""
}, metadata={
EXEC_MIME: {"server_id": server_id}
})
return server
def show_embed(panel, max_states=1000, max_opts=3, json=False,
json_prefix='', save_path='./', load_path=None,
progress=True, states={}):
"""
Renders a static version of a panel in a notebook by evaluating
the set of states defined by the widgets in the model. Note
this will only work well for simple apps with a relatively
small state space.
Arguments
---------
max_states: int
The maximum number of states to embed
max_opts: int
The maximum number of states for a single widget
json: boolean (default=True)
Whether to export the data to json files
json_prefix: str (default='')
Prefix for JSON filename
save_path: str (default='./')
The path to save json files to
load_path: str (default=None)
The path or URL the json files will be loaded from.
progress: boolean (default=False)
Whether to report progress
states: dict (default={})
A dictionary specifying the widget values to embed for each widget
"""
from IPython.display import publish_display_data
from ..config import config
doc = Document()
comm = Comm()
with config.set(embed=True):
model = panel.get_root(doc, comm)
embed_state(panel, model, doc, max_states, max_opts,
json, json_prefix, save_path, load_path, progress,
states)
publish_display_data(*render_model(model))
def ipywidget(obj, **kwargs):
"""
Creates a root model from the Panel object and wraps it in
a jupyter_bokeh ipywidget BokehModel.
Arguments
---------
obj: object
Any Panel object or object which can be rendered with Panel
**kwargs: dict
Keyword arguments passed to the pn.panel utility function
Returns
-------
Returns an ipywidget model which renders the Panel object.
"""
from jupyter_bokeh.widgets import BokehModel
from ..pane import panel
model = panel(obj, **kwargs).get_root()
widget = BokehModel(model, combine_events=True)
if hasattr(widget, '_view_count'):
widget._view_count = 0
def view_count_changed(change, current=[model]):
new_model = None
if change['old'] > 0 and change['new'] == 0 and current:
try:
obj._cleanup(current[0])
except Exception:
pass
current[:] = []
elif (change['old'] == 0 and change['new'] > 0 and
(not current or current[0] is not model)):
if current:
try:
obj._cleanup(current[0])
except Exception:
pass
new_model = obj.get_root()
widget.update_from_model(new_model)
current[:] = [new_model]
widget.observe(view_count_changed, '_view_count')
return widget
